Its important to note if you leave any of these windows except for the log when the level switches the game will crash actor name You can then take that name like this: class'stripper'level0.stripper_0 taking the name of the actor you can then go to console and type in editactor name=stripper_0 So if you were looking at a enemy this field would be set to the enemies class followed by the level name. Within the None tree on the window you'll see a variable called LookActor which will be set at whatever your looking at. Type editactor class=DukePlayer this will bring up a editor window with all variables for the player, which you can change such as movement speed, god mode, and other various things.
